Nike Air Max 720

The Air Max 720 gets yet another new colorway.

Nike has gone all out when it comes to bringing us brand new colorways for the Nike Air Max 720. Why wouldn't they? It's their latest Air Max model which improves upon the Air Max 270 by giving consumers an Air Max unit that wraps all the way around the shoe. It's a phenomenal concept that pays off due to its immense comfort. The ambitiousness of the shoe can be compared to that of the original Nike Vapormax which was originally laughed at by sneakerheads. Eventually, people came around because of just how great the shoe was. While the air max unit is unique, perhaps the most interesting feature is the wavy tooling on the upper.

So far, Nike hasn't really taken advantage of the funky tooling, as they've been going for more solid and gradient colorways. It appears that is about to change though as a new colorway has emerged that shows off multiple different shades of grey. In the image above, you can see that almost every nook and cranny of the shoe has a unique shade to it. Black highlights are found here and there while the air max unit is completely translucent.
